Job Description
  • Create security roles, access and domains within the Oracle HCM Cloud platform. Ensure data security across applications and documents.
  • Lead upgrades and application patching by studying the documents provided by Oracle, analyzing the impact, reviewing the impacts with the stakeholders and obtain their approval. Update the process guides/documents as needed.
  • Proven experience in full development life cycle and significant experience in delivering applications and architecture services in a production environment. Enterprise-level business project experience with strong process analysis, design, and documentation.
  • Design, own solutions and create architecture specifications for global Oracle HCM solutions with specific experience around Cloud, Fusion and Data Migration.
  • Partner cross functionally to understand business functional requirements and execute through successful implementation, testing and deployment within Oracle HCM Cloud with required technical documentation, peer review and approval.
  • Champions process/customer service improvements, innovative solutions. Uses Process and technical know-how to obtain appropriate approval prior to implementation.
  • Conducts training, develops user procedures and guidelines. Trains clients on new processes/functionality. Trains new system users.
  • Provide functional consulting services by acting as subject matter expert. Lead business owners through the entire implementation lifecycle.
  • Serve as a tiered SME escalation point for end user issue resolution.
  • Proven experience in a Functional/Architectural role for Oracle HCM Cloud.
  • Use data loading techniques (HDL and spreadsheet loaders) for mass data uploads. Demonstrate understanding and confidence in understanding data extracts and reporting capabilities of the Oracle products. HDL Integration Experience / Integration Experience with other systems.
  • Configure (and/or oversee configuration efforts) and develop Oracle HCM Cloud modules including core HR, Benefits, Absence, Talent & Performance, Absence and Compensation to meet client requirements.
  • Participate in User Group Meetings and conferences.
